[livejournal.com profile] _greg and I decided that we would do all things at once. There were backup plans for every possible problem. Right? Of course, right.

Yesterday the server moved to the E Street Cafe.

Three things had to happen. 1) The Spiffy OpenBSD firewall had to be hooked up and tested, 2) the DNS records for all the domains had to be changed and 3) hermes (the server) had to have configuration files changed to match the new IPs.

The firewall failed entirely to allow any packets through the bridge. For hours and hours it failed. When I last left our hero, the firewall was back out of the circuit. It will have to be worked on.

With only about 90 minutes left before I had to be at RHPS, I started up hermes to reconfigure it. An easy job. Except that damn machine failed to start up. It wouldn't even do it's own pretest. Greg went home and grabbed another machine. Hard drive swap and hermes was back on line. I was late to the show.

The only piece that seems to gone off without a hitch is the DNS change.
